Warehouse and distribution network roles include warehouse operators, inventory and stock handling, picking and packing, and shift supervision. Transport and road freight roles include dispatchers, freight forwarding specialists, customs and documentation support, and transport process coordination. Planning and supply chain management roles include Supply Planner and Regional Supply Planner positions, demand and inventory optimization, performance monitoring, and value stream analysis. Digital and Technology roles support system upgrades, big data and data science work, automation, and the digital solutions that keep a supply chain moving. Around these sit Finance, Legal, Human Resources, Marketing, Research and Development, sales and admin functions that support logistics operations and manufacturing sites.\n\nEmployers in the Polish market range from local transport and freight forwarding companies to global manufacturers and consumer goods groups. For operational roles, reliability, shift flexibility, safety awareness and basic systems knowledge matter most. For office and planning roles, employers usually look for supply chain management knowledge, comfort with data, cost awareness and the ability to optimize workflows against agreed logistics standards. For technology roles, experience with automation, digitalisation, integrations and system upgrades is valuable. Language expectations vary: Polish is often required for site-level operational and customer service work, while English is common in regional planning, finance, digital and technology teams inside global network organisations.\n\nExplore what moves us and what could move you. Young talents entering the Polish logistics market usually have three routes: apprenticeships and vocational training linked to warehouse, production and transport work; graduate and trainee programmes run by larger employers, sometimes including Engineering Associate style tracks; and entry-level office roles in customer service, planning support or administration that build supply chain knowledge quickly.
